Re: Development of cross-platform GUI for Open Source DBs



I can't speak for wxPython etc., but regarding using QT from C++, your speed of development depends on your C++ skills. I wrote a full-featured Point of Sale system in Visual Basic that has been in active use for about 4 years. The original development effort (screens, grids, etc.) took about 3 weeks. I got tired of supporting an app that I had to lug out my Windows/VB laptop for, so I decided to port it to C++ so I could develop on my Linux box. I ported the entire thing over to C++/QT in about a week.

QT is *extremely* good. My speed with developing GUI applications in C++ is now on par with my abilities in VB...And I can't think of a tool on earth faster than VB for cranking out quick-n-dirty apps :P
